About this Marketing Role
The Marketing organization influences decisions by establishing and communicating our full product value proposition across the full value chain, from payers, to health systems, to prescribers, to patients. Marketers are masterful storytellers - accountable to inform positioning using an insight-driven marketing strategy, deliver simple compelling customer-led content creation, and design outstanding integrated customer experiences in partnership with networked partners (e.g., Customer Engagement and Genentech Business Operations). Marketers strategically use resources and their network to drive patient outcomes for today’s innovations, and fuel tomorrow’s breakthroughs.
*Organized Customer can include Payers, Hospital systems, PBMs, Group Purchasing Organizations, Financial Decision-Makers, or Practice Managers
This Sr. Customer Marketing Manager reports to the Organized Customer Marketing Team Director and is integral to successfully delivering the Solid Tumor marketing vision and network goals, specifically leading access launch activities and pioneering organizational capabilities in the Pharmacy Benefit, Part D space:
Leading the Launch Access Team and the overall Organized Customer marketing strategy
Establishing and optimizing critical elements of the patient experience (e.g., access, fulfillment, patient support services)
Optimizing brand profitability through specific marketing channels for targeted access customer segments / financial decision makers
Working closely with the marketers and cross-functional partners on the team to deliver on the payer/provider value prop and overall Day 1 Access readiness
Key Job Responsibilities
Strategy
Supports the development and execution of the customer strategy and the end-to-end integrated customer experience
Supports tailored and actionable omnichannel customer engagement, leveraging appropriate customer insights including customer journeys, personas, market/competitor insights and other data needed, collaborating closely with the Customer Marketer Lead
Content
Responsible for planning and executing seamless, well-integrated marketing campaigns that include tailored omnichannel engagement plans across multiple marketing platforms and channels
Oversees the design and creation of core materials with Agencies of Record (AoR), websites, claims, components, tailoring original content to specific customer segments and personas while monitoring timelines and content handoffs
Self-authors derivative tactics for marketing campaigns leveraging existing and emerging technologies/capabilities, with a greater emphasis on new derivatives and incorporates post-Promotional Review Committee (PRC) edits and adjustments
Supports field deployment through communication, training and feedback loops
Hypothesizes and conducts experiments for creative content iteration, for the purpose of driving excellence in content creation and deployment
Partners with agencies and PRC, including Legal and Regulatory, to ensure development, approval, and pull-through of compliant and effective promotional tactics
Execution
Accountable for high quality, compliant execution across all marketing platforms and relevant customer types (e.g. patients, providers, organized customers)
Defines measurement plan and measures marketing performance through leading, lagging, and customer satisfaction indicators to optimize campaigns and drive customer and business outcomes
